Vancouver Canucks Secure Jake DeBrusk in Seven-Year Deal

The Vancouver Canucks have solidified their lineup by signing Jake DeBrusk to a lucrative seven-year contract worth $5.5 million annually. This move comes after other potential targets like Tyler Toffoli opted for San Jose, directing the Canucks’ attention to DeBrusk. General Manager Patrik Allvin expressed satisfaction with the deal, highlighting DeBrusk’s size, pedigree, and aggressive playing style that aligns well with Canucks head coach Tocc‘s vision.

In addition to securing DeBrusk, the Canucks made several other signings to bolster their team, including Kiefer Sherwood, Danton Heinen, Nate Smith, Derek Forbort, Vincent Desharnais, and Jiri Patera. Allvin emphasized the need for increased speed and depth in the team’s forward lines.

DeBrusk, a seasoned winger from the Boston Bruins, brings a wealth of experience with two 27-goal seasons and a recent 40-point performance. His playoff tenacity was also evident with 11 points in 13 games. Allvin sees DeBrusk as a potential linemate for star players like J.T. Miller or Elias Pettersson, adding versatility to the Canucks’ offensive capabilities.

Speaking about his signing, DeBrusk expressed eagerness to join the Canucks and praised the team’s competitive spirit and desire to win. He acknowledged the strong center lineup in Vancouver and acknowledged the growth potential after their recent playoff success. DeBrusk also emphasized his commitment to improving his consistency and defensive play under Tocc’s coaching.

The connection with his father, Louie DeBrusk, a former NHL player and Tocc’s former teammate, adds a personal touch to Jake’s decision. Louie’s influence and dedication to his son’s training played a significant role in Jake’s career development and readiness for the NHL.

While DeBrusk’s signing marks a shift from the Canucks’ initial plans, the team is confident in his abilities to contribute to their offensive and special teams units. With a focus on consistency and physical play, DeBrusk’s addition is expected to elevate the Canucks’ performance in the upcoming season.
